Jewell Belote, aged 50, tragically lost her life on June 18, 1990, as a victim of a mass shooting in Jacksonville, Florida. This horrific event, known as the GMAC massacre, was perpetrated by James Edward Pough, a 42-year-old man who went on a deadly rampage over two days. On June 17, 1990, Pough began his spree by randomly shooting and killing two people on Jacksonville's Northside, wounding two teenagers, and robbing a convenience store.
